Job Description :
Position: Salesforce Architect

Location: Waukegan, IL

Duration: 6-12 Months

The Salesforce Architect is responsible for meeting, communicating and reviewing CRM requirements. Will work directly with the CRM team and clients to determine, design and implement CRM solution. Work closely with internal and external teams on various projects related to CRM.

· Work within CRM team to review customer needs on a regular basis
· Develop and document CRM plans and strategies for client''s review
· Meet with clients to review, document and communicate CRM requirements
· Maintain SalesForce.com training and certification on a regular basis
· Work with clients to understand CRM requirements and map to technology
· Document requirements gathered from clients and present them back for signoff
· Work with clients to design and implement CRM solution
· Understand and document requirements for configuring, test and launch CRM solution
· Collaborate and communicate with multiple client teams and vendors as needed in the scope of the project
· Participate in weekly project resource meetings
· Ensure that all time tracking is on time and completed for projects
Requirements:

Minimum of 4 years of experience implementing CRM solutions from start to finish
3+ years as a Salesforce administrator or Salesforce system implementer
SalesForce.com Administrator certification strongly preferred
Bachelor’s Degree Required
Strong understanding of SalesForce.com best practices and functionality
Demonstrated ability to meet deadlines, handle and prioritize simultaneous requests and manage laterally and upward with a positive attitude
Excellent interpersonal communication skills
Experience working with sandbox and production environments to manage the distribution of system functional or process changes
Excellent data skills from mapping to scheduling data integration and ETL and data analysis
Excellent analysis skills
Strong knowledge of the sales cycle and how CRM plays a role as a sales solution
Experience working with Salesforce doing custom reporting, modifying pages, views and dashboards, etc.
Experience working with workflows and triggers to automate tasks
Solid understanding of sales and marketing analytics, including reporting on pipeline health, forecasting, campaign effectiveness and data-quality metrics
